Parade of Seniors is open to all member's sled dogs, ten years and older. Please send those dog's names to me by April 30th. susanlscofield@gmail.com In addition to receiving their scarf, the dogs walk the Parade of Honor and have their name announced over the PA. Huzzah!
Rainbow Bridge Memorial honors all member's dogs that have crossed the Bridge in this past year. Those names, date of birth and death go to Karla Boyle. Closing date on that is also April 30th. karlaandjourney@gmail.com Karla creates a beautiful rainbow wind chime, in memory of our missing friends, that hangs at Camp K.
